fn truncate(mut arena: Arena) {
  let mut b = arena.alloc_bytes(100).unwrap();
  b.set_len(100);
  b.fill(1);
  unsafe {
    b.detach();
  }
  let offset = b.offset();
  drop(b);

  let allocated = arena.allocated();
  let _ = arena.truncate(2048);

  assert_eq!(arena.allocated(), allocated);
  assert_eq!(arena.capacity(), 2048);

  unsafe {
    assert_eq!(arena.get_bytes(offset, 100), [1u8; 100]);
  }

  let _ = arena.truncate(0);
  assert_eq!(arena.allocated(), allocated);
  assert_eq!(arena.capacity(), allocated);

  unsafe {
    assert_eq!(arena.get_bytes(offset, 100), [1u8; 100]);
  }

  let err = arena.alloc_bytes(10).unwrap_err();
  assert!(matches!(err, Error::InsufficientSpace { .. }));

  let _ = arena.truncate(allocated + 100);
  assert_eq!(arena.allocated(), allocated);
  assert_eq!(arena.capacity(), allocated + 100);

  let b = arena.alloc_bytes(10).unwrap();
  assert_eq!(b.capacity(), 10);
}
